*nix Documentation Project
·  Home
 +   man pages
·  Linux HOWTOs
·  FreeBSD Tips
·  *niX Forums

  man pages->HP-UX 11i man pages -> tt_message_disposition (3)              


 tt_message_disposition(library call)   tt_message_disposition(library call)

 NAME    [Toc]    [Back]
      tt_message_disposition - retrieve the disposition attribute from a

 SYNOPSIS    [Toc]    [Back]
      #include <Tt/tt_c.h>
      Tt_disposition tt_message_disposition(
      Tt_message m);

 DESCRIPTION    [Toc]    [Back]
      The tt_message_disposition function retrieves the disposition
      attribute from the specified message.

      The m argument is the opaque handle for the message involved in this

 RETURN VALUE    [Toc]    [Back]
      Upon successful completion, the tt_message_disposition function
      returns a value that indicates whether an instance of the receiving
      process should be started to receive the message immediately, or
      whether the message is to be queued until the receiving process is
      started at a later time.  The tt_message_disposition function returns
      one of the following Tt_disposition values:

                There is no receiver for this message.  The message will be
                returned to the sender with the Tt_status field containing

      TT_QUEUE  Queue the message until a process of the proper ptype
                receives the message.

      TT_START  Attempt to start a process of the proper ptype if none is

                Queue the message and attempt to start a process of the
                proper ptype if none is running.

      The application can use tt_int_error(3) to extract one of the
      following Tt_status values from the Tt_disposition integer:

      TT_OK     The operation completed successfully.

                The ttsession(1) process is not running and the ToolTalk
                service cannot restart it.

                The pointer passed does not point to an object of the
                correct type for this operation.

                                    - 1 -       Formatted:  January 24, 2005

 tt_message_disposition(library call)   tt_message_disposition(library call)

 SEE ALSO    [Toc]    [Back]
      Tt/tt_c.h - Tttt_c(5), tt_int_error(3).

                                    - 2 -       Formatted:  January 24, 2005
[ Back ]
 Similar pages
Name OS Title
tt_message_disposition_set HP-UX set the disposition attribute for a message
tt_message_class HP-UX retrieve the class attribute from a message
tt_message_op HP-UX retrieve the operation attribute from a message
tt_message_scope HP-UX retrieve the scope attribute from a message
tt_message_sender HP-UX retrieve the sender attribute from a message
tt_message_session HP-UX retrieve the session attribute from a message
tt_message_address HP-UX retrieve the address attribute from a message
tt_message_object HP-UX retrieve the object attribute from a message
tt_message_status HP-UX retrieve the status attribute from a message
tt_message_state HP-UX retrieve the state attribute from a message
Copyright © 2004-2005 DeniX Solutions SRL
newsletter delivery service